Transaction 8e42e64e6a63f3a2b5054e72bdb3672f9c8c788080240e7c4ca08105811963b2

1 Input
2 Outputs
  • 8e42e64e6a63f3a2b5054e72bdb3672f9c8c788080240e7c4ca08105811963b2:0
  • value  1077554068
    address  1BTotrBaha42a95DHAbkz4UsvDF1Axa7A6
  • 8e42e64e6a63f3a2b5054e72bdb3672f9c8c788080240e7c4ca08105811963b2:1
  • value  8200000
    address  15iGraTqZVQ3fgnqnQVcuZg8cjCdbzhx9w